Adds 23 new sections to Missouri law (sections 448.500-448.615) creating the Common Interest Owners Bill of Rights Act, applicable to all condominiums and residential common interest communities with 12+ units in Missouri.
-
Establishes governance requirements including mandatory annual unit owner meetings, open executive board meetings (except closed executive sessions), notice provisions for proposed amendments and rules, and procedures for amending declarations requiring 50-67% unit owner approval.
-
Grants unit owners inspection and copying rights to association records within 5 business days, requires associations to maintain detailed financial records and meeting minutes, and permits unit owners to remove executive board members and officers without cause by majority vote.
-
Restricts association foreclosure actions to cases where owners owe at least 3 months of assessments and the executive board votes specifically to foreclose, and requires commercially reasonable foreclosure procedures.
-
Provides that all contracts and duties under the act must be performed in good faith, allows disputes to be resolved through alternative dispute resolution, and permits courts to award reasonable attorney's fees and costs for violations, with punitive damages available for willful non-compliance.
